OpenSpace has gained significant traction in the construction industry, with over 24 billion square feet captured across more than 33,000 projects globally. The platform’s computer vision technology maps the captured images to the project plans, creating a fully navigable digital twin of the construction site. By using autonomous devices like robots and drones equipped with lidar and 360-degree cameras, Doxel captures comprehensive visual data of construction sites on a daily basis. ALICE Technologies is the world’s first AI-powered construction optioneering platform that empowers contractors to plan, bid, and build projects more effectively. Procore’s platform is built for the construction industry and offers a full range of products and solutions for project management, quality and safety, design coordination, BIM, financials, and field productivity.
